Features

  • 10 .EXEllent Games Available as a single collection or as part of two separate digital volumes, the full list of titles in the Mega Man Battle Network Legacy Collection includes: Mega Man Battle Network, Mega Man Battle Network 2, Mega Man Battle Network 3 White, Mega Man Battle Network 3 Blue, Mega Man Battle Network 4 Red Sun, Mega Man Battle Network 4 Blue Moon, Mega Man Battle Network 5 Team Protoman, Mega Man Battle Network 5 Team Colonel, Mega Man Battle Network 6 Cybeast Gregar & Mega Man Battle Network 6 Cybeast Falzar
  • Rocking Tunes Rock out to some tunes in the Music Player, which includes more than 180 tracks from all 10 titles.
  • Roll Through the Gallery Network Navigators will be able to access over 1,000 pieces of concept art, character sketches, and official illustrations in the collections Gallery. The Mystery Data section will contain exclusive illustrations from past events and images of licensed goods from this era of Mega Man titles.
  • Crisp Visual Filters Optional high resolution filters allow pla yers to enjoy smoother, less pixelated visuals. Players can turn the filters off/on at any time if they would prefer to enjoy the original visuals of the Battle Network games.
  • Collect and Trade with Fri ends NetBattlers on the h unt for specific Battle Chips and MegaMan.EXE styles can collect and exchange with other NetBattlers around the world

  • Very good collection
As far as collections go, this one is quite good. I really appreciate the borders for modern TVs, and the filter options are a nice touch to make sure the game looks good on the big screen. It's also really cool that all the missing content from Battle Network 6 has been restored, and can be played officially in English for the first time. It also includes online multiplayer - not every game needs it, but it's a quality of life improvement that the series needed, now that it's no longer constrained to old hardware. However, this is a warts-and-all re-release - no tweaking, very few other quality of life updates. The games do allow you to access the eReader cards that were Japan-exclusive whenever you want, which is nice and can prevent some softlocks in some games. On launch, there was a way to softlock yourself in the English language version of Battle Network 6, but that's since been patched. So, make sure your game is updated before doing the Battle Network 6 post-game. This game will not fix some of the problems people had with Battle Network 4, or even the clunkiness of the original Battle Network. So, keep that in mind. Regardless, the Battle Network Series is a lot of fun, with some pretty unique mechanics, one that doesn't neatly fit into a genre, but in the best kind of way. ... show more

  • Another Mega Man Legacy Collection to add to the collection.
I was really hopeful that Capcom would do a Battle Network collection, following the classic, X and Zero/ZX legacy collections. Thankfully it happened (fingers crossed for a Legends and Star Force collection). This is the best way to experience the BN series. This collection contains both volumes 1 &2. Vol. 1 has Battle Network 1, 2 and both versions of 3. Vol 2. Contains both versions of games 4, 5 and 6. Much needed quality of life improvements have made things so much better, and supposedly the grammatical errors that the BN series has been known for, have been fixed as well. The inclusion of a switchable buster max mode will help cut through some of the more tedious parts in some of the games. This collection includes all of the Japan only content that was removed in other versions. Such as the Boktai cross over side missions, extra bosses and all of the incredibly rare chips and e-reader card gifts. The game is a love letter to Battle Network fans. They even got Mega Man Exe’s voice actor from the English dub of the anime, to reprise the role and be your guide for the main menu between Vols 1 & 2. Included along with the 10 games, are galleries of music, art work, concept art and other promotional art. My only gripe is that Battle Network Chip Challenge, Operate Shooting Star and the DS version of Battle Network 5 is not included with the collection. There’s also online Player vs Player and Chip trading to help fill out the library across all 10 games. There’s also no significant difference in performance in the Switch port compared to other ports. ... show more
